Secret Inspection Processes



Reliable welding examination counts on a series of essential processes made to review the quality and stability of welds. These processes include both aesthetic and non-destructive testing (NDT) techniques, making certain that any issues are recognized before they jeopardize architectural integrity.


The initial step in the assessment procedure is a comprehensive visual assessment, which enables assessors to examine welds for surface area flaws such as fractures, undercuts, and insufficient combination. Complying with visual checks, various NDT strategies might be employed, including ultrasonic screening, magnetic fragment screening, and radiographic testing. Each method uses distinct benefits; as an example, ultrasonic screening can spot inner flaws, while radiographic screening offers an irreversible record of the weld's interior structure.




Furthermore, it is critical to confirm conformity with pertinent codes and standards, making sure that the weld fulfills industry specifications. This includes examining weld measurements and positioning, as inappropriate dimensions can lead to failures under lots.

Common Issues and Their Detection



Welds, similar to the foundation of structural honesty in building and construction and production, can show numerous flaws that compromise their efficiency and safety and security. Typical flaws include porosity, fractures, undercut, lack of fusion, and slag additions (Welding Inspection Gilbert Arizona). Each of these imperfections can manifest because of inappropriate welding strategies, poor material choice, or poor preparation

Porosity refers to little gas pockets entraped within the weld, which can weaken the joint. Cracks may develop because of thermal stresses or unsuitable cooling prices and can lead to tragic failures if not addressed. Undercut happens when the base product is eliminated throughout welding, resulting in damaged locations along the weld toe. Lack of blend symbolizes inadequate bonding in between the weld steel and the base product, endangering stamina. Slag additions are non-metallic deposits that end up being trapped in the weld bead, potentially leading this post to failure.




Discovery of these flaws can be accomplished through various non-destructive testing methods, including visual assessment, ultrasonic screening, and radiographic testing. Each technique plays a crucial role in identifying these faults, making sure that the honesty of the weld is kept and decreasing the danger of failing in essential applications.

Ideal Practices for High Quality Guarantee





Making certain the best quality of welds is paramount for architectural integrity and safety and security, especially in industries where the effects of failure can be extreme. To accomplish this, several ideal methods for quality guarantee have to be applied throughout the welding procedure.


First, a durable welding treatment specification (WPS) ought to be developed, describing the necessary criteria for every welding operation. This makes sure uniformity and adherence to industry requirements. Second, detailed training and qualification of welders are necessary; skilled employees are much better furnished to produce high-grade welds and acknowledge prospective issues.


Routine examinations should be integrated into the welding procedure, using both aesthetic and non-destructive testing (NDT) techniques to discover imperfections beforehand. Normal calibration of assessment devices is important to preserve accuracy. Furthermore, recording all welding activities, including evaluations and corrective activities, creates a deducible record that can be indispensable for quality control.
